From 5bbda3309d3cbb3bf370f1dd409cd841de2fd53d Mon Sep 17 00:00:00 2001 From: madonuko Date: Thu, 13 Feb 2025 20:47:10 +0800 Subject: [PATCH] feat: branch off frawhide to f42 --- .backportrc.json | 2 +- .devcontainer/devcontainer.json | 10 +++------- .github/workflows/autobuild.yml | 10 +++++----- .github/workflows/bootstrap.yml | 2 +- .github/workflows/build.yml | 2 +- .github/workflows/json-build.yml | 2 +- .github/workflows/update-branch.yml | 8 +++----- .github/workflows/update-comps.yml | 3 ++- 8 files changed, 17 insertions(+), 22 deletions(-) diff --git a/.backportrc.json b/.backportrc.json index 1c7b5305f4..c09fd186f0 100644 --- a/.backportrc.json +++ b/.backportrc.json @@ -2,7 +2,7 @@ "repoOwner": "terrapkg", "repoName": "packages", "resetAuthor": true, - "targetBranchChoices": ["f39", "f40", "frawhide"], + "targetBranchChoices": ["f39", "f40", "f41", "f42", "frawhide"], "branchLabelMapping": { "^sync-(.+)$": "$1" } diff --git a/.devcontainer/devcontainer.json b/.devcontainer/devcontainer.json index 96c9104ef2..1e7531ca2d 100644 --- a/.devcontainer/devcontainer.json +++ b/.devcontainer/devcontainer.json @@ -1,17 +1,13 @@ { "name": "Terra Devcontainer", - "image": "ghcr.io/terrapkg/builder:frawhide", - "runArgs": [ - "--privileged" - ], + "image": "ghcr.io/terrapkg/builder:f42", + "runArgs": ["--privileged"], "features": { "ghcr.io/devcontainers/features/common-utils:2": {} }, "customizations": { "vscode": { - "extensions": [ - "rhaiscript.vscode-rhai" - ] + "extensions": ["rhaiscript.vscode-rhai"] } }, "remoteUser": "vscode", diff --git a/.github/workflows/autobuild.yml b/.github/workflows/autobuild.yml index 19bf560f06..b741656bd6 100644 --- a/.github/workflows/autobuild.yml +++ b/.github/workflows/autobuild.yml @@ -6,13 +6,13 @@ on: paths: - anda/** branches: - - frawhide + - f42 pull_request: branches: - - frawhide + - f42 merge_group: branches: - - frawhide + - f42 workflow_dispatch: workflow_call: @@ -22,7 +22,7 @@ jobs: outputs: build_matrix: ${{ steps.generate_build_matrix.outputs.build_matrix }} container: - image: ghcr.io/terrapkg/builder:frawhide + image: ghcr.io/terrapkg/builder:f42 options: --cap-add=SYS_ADMIN --privileged steps: - name: Set workspace as safe @@ -39,7 +39,7 @@ jobs: strategy: matrix: pkg: ${{ fromJson(needs.manifest.outputs.build_matrix) }} - version: ["rawhide"] + version: ["42"] fail-fast: false runs-on: ${{ (matrix.pkg.arch == 'aarch64' && matrix.pkg.labels['large']) && 'ARM64' || matrix.pkg.arch == 'aarch64' && 'ubuntu-22.04-arm' || matrix.pkg.labels['large'] && 'x86-64-lg' || 'ubuntu-22.04' }} container: diff --git a/.github/workflows/bootstrap.yml b/.github/workflows/bootstrap.yml index 56a7e75322..f09ea6130a 100644 --- a/.github/workflows/bootstrap.yml +++ b/.github/workflows/bootstrap.yml @@ -7,7 +7,7 @@ jobs: bootstrap: strategy: matrix: - version: ["rawhide"] + version: ["42"] arch: ["x86_64", "aarch64"] fail-fast: true runs-on: ${{ matrix.arch == 'aarch64' && 'ARM64' || 'ubuntu-22.04' }} diff --git a/.github/workflows/build.yml b/.github/workflows/build.yml index 4d27dd60ae..caa4c6f35b 100644 --- a/.github/workflows/build.yml +++ b/.github/workflows/build.yml @@ -44,7 +44,7 @@ jobs: strategy: matrix: pkg: ${{ fromJson(needs.parse.outputs.pkgs) }} - version: ["rawhide"] + version: ["42"] arch: ${{ fromJson(needs.parse.outputs.arch) }} fail-fast: false runs-on: ${{ matrix.arch == 'aarch64' && 'ARM64' || needs.parse.outputs.builder && needs.parse.outputs.builder || 'ubuntu-22.04' }} diff --git a/.github/workflows/json-build.yml b/.github/workflows/json-build.yml index 20a94c6e1c..0077c425e1 100644 --- a/.github/workflows/json-build.yml +++ b/.github/workflows/json-build.yml @@ -11,7 +11,7 @@ jobs: strategy: matrix: pkg: ${{ fromJson(inputs.packages) }} - version: ["rawhide"] + version: ["42"] fail-fast: false runs-on: ${{ (matrix.pkg.arch == 'aarch64' && matrix.pkg.labels['large']) && 'ARM64' || matrix.pkg.arch == 'aarch64' && 'ubuntu-22.04-arm' || matrix.pkg.labels['large'] && 'x86-64-lg' || 'ubuntu-22.04' }} container: diff --git a/.github/workflows/update-branch.yml b/.github/workflows/update-branch.yml index ecd9b4b23d..42289d4f52 100644 --- a/.github/workflows/update-branch.yml +++ b/.github/workflows/update-branch.yml @@ -13,9 +13,10 @@ jobs: - frawhide - f40 - f41 + - f42 - el10 container: - image: ghcr.io/terrapkg/builder:frawhide + image: ghcr.io/terrapkg/builder:f42 options: --cap-add=SYS_ADMIN --privileged steps: - name: Checkout @@ -33,10 +34,7 @@ jobs: git config --global --add safe.directory "$GITHUB_WORKSPACE" - name: Run Update - run: | - nbranch="${{ matrix.branch }}" - [ "$nbranch" = 'frawhide' ] && nbranch='f42' - anda update --filters updbranch=1 --labels branch=${{ matrix.branch }},nbranch=$nbranch + run: anda update --filters updbranch=1 --labels branch=${{ matrix.branch }} env: G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}} RUST_BACKTRACE: full diff --git a/.github/workflows/update-comps.yml b/.github/workflows/update-comps.yml index adad0d0133..657b739725 100644 --- a/.github/workflows/update-comps.yml +++ b/.github/workflows/update-comps.yml @@ -4,6 +4,7 @@ on: push: branches: - frawhide + - f42 - f41 - f40 - el10 @@ -15,7 +16,7 @@ jobs: update-comps: runs-on: ubuntu-22.04 container: - image: ghcr.io/terrapkg/builder:frawhide + image: ghcr.io/terrapkg/builder:f42 steps: - uses: actions/checkout@v4 - name: Push to subatomic